Why is this golden spice getting so much attention? The turmeric pigment curcumin, which gives the spice its anti-inflammatory and antioxidant properties, is the key. Curcumin 750 mg beneficial properties Curcumin's acceptance in conventional and complementary medicine may be ascribed to its advantageous effects on free radical damage and low-level inflammation, two variables connected to numerous chronic disorders. Studies demonstrate that curcumin, like the drugs acetaminophen and ibuprofen, decreases inflammation by downregulating the COX-2 enzyme. Nitric oxide is vital, but it can also contribute to the effects of chronic inflammation that cause disease. Inhibiting the metabolism of arachidonic acid, an omega-6 fatty acid that promotes inflammation, according to another study, may help Curcumin Softgels reduce inflammation and free radical damage.
Limiting the production of cytokines that cause inflammation.
Encouraging the process of apoptosis, which causes damaged cells to die in a controlled manner Additionally, Curcumin 750 mg functions as an antioxidant, scavenging free radicals that might otherwise cause cellular harm. Atoms that are unstable and are missing one electron are called free radicals. Numerous illnesses, including arthritis, asthma, atherosclerosis, diabetes, and dementia, have been linked to them.
Neurons can create new connections at any time.
Yet another benefit of curcumin is that it may promote the creation of new neurons in specific regions of the brain by raising levels of a hormone called brain-derived neurotrophic factor. A double-blind, placebo-controlled trial in the American Journal of Geriatric Psychiatry found that older persons with mild memory loss who took 90 mg of curcumin turmeric twice a day for 18 months experienced memory improvements of up to 28%. The study authors reported that people taking Curcumin 750 mg also reported improved focus and a little uptick in mood. Curcumin does have a drawback.
It turns out that this bright yellow compound's lack of solubility can limit its efficiency by making it difficult for the body to absorb. Additionally, Curcumin Softgels are quickly processed in the digestive system and promptly excreted by the body. In order to improve bioavailability and absorption, numerous versions of Curcumin Softgels have been created utilizing various technologies, including:
